In the article, "Franchisors Should Be Hands-off Concerning Franchisee Compliance Training," featured in HRDive, Randy Coffey discusses how Franchisors can minimize their liability in joint-employer claims.
Randy Coffey, an attorney with Kansas City-based Fisher Phillips, told SHRM that franchisors can avoid interactions with franchisees that could trigger joint-employer claims by giving franchisees literature on compliance training instead of in-house training.
